Job Description:
As a Technical Writer, you will be responsible for working independently on components of an information development project. You will contribute to the team on a variety of projects and call upon team members for guidance as needed. You will contribute to the team and work independently.
Experience Range:
5 - 7 years
Job Responsibilities:
- Strong writing skills, namely a command of grammar, syntax, diction, and the conventions and best practices of writing a variety of technical documents.
- Experience in using the Darwin Information Typing Architecture (DITA).
- Good knowledge and writing experience using XML-based authoring tools such as oXygen XML Editor.
- Create and maintain Online Help, Installation Guide, Upgrade Guide, Deployment Guide, Release Notes, Support Matrix, and other such product documentation deliverables.
- Design, develop, and write technically accurate and comprehensive product documentation that adheres to the MSTP.
- Understanding of core information development processes: content planning, content creation, and content review.
- Fundamental skills with the authoring tools used by the information development teams.
- Fundamental collaboration skills: Ability to work with cross-functional teams and other writers for updates in the product or the process.
- Ensure strict adherence to the delivery schedule by planning, tracking, and delivering as per sprint commitments.
- Participate in daily scrum meetings, development design reviews, and documentation reviews.
Skills Required:
DITA XML, XMetal, Oxygen XML Editor, MSTP, Astoria, Visual Studio, Agile Environment, Software Development Life Cycle (SDLC),
Desired Characteristics:
- Fundamental knowledge of core technical communication concepts, such as topic-based authoring, minimalism, task-oriented design, single-sourcing.
- Experience with content management systems, such as Astoria and Visual Studio.
- Basic skills in editing (QA for documentation) – ability to recognize errors in a variety of information deliverables.
- Working knowledge of Lean/Agile/XP software development processes and how to follow processes for information development.
- Working knowledge of major aspects of software design, development, and QA and how they affect the information development process.
